Summary
White Lake Middle School - 03 is a small public middle school serving grades 6-8 in White Lake, South Dakota, with just 23 students. The school is part of the White Lake School District 01-3, which is ranked 109 out of 147 school districts in the state and has a 1-star rating from SchoolDigger.
Academically, White Lake Middle School - 03 consistently performs below the state and district averages in Smarter Balanced Assessments for English Language Arts, Mathematics, and Science. For example, in 2024-2025, the school's proficiency rates were 17.85% in ELA, 25% in Math, and 30% in Science, compared to the state averages of 50.93%, 43.49%, and 42.51%, respectively. The school's performance has declined over the years, with its statewide ranking dropping from 5th out of 147 middle schools in 2017-2018 to 190th out of 246 in 2024-2025. Compared to nearby schools, White Lake Middle School - 03 lags behind Kimball Middle School - 04, which has significantly higher proficiency rates in all subject areas.
The school faces other challenges as well. It has a high percentage of students from low socioeconomic backgrounds, with 56.52% of students qualifying for free or reduced-price lunch in 2023-2024. Additionally, White Lake Middle School - 03 has consistently high chronic absenteeism rates, ranging from 16.3% to 20.8% in recent years, which is significantly higher than the state average. While the school spends a relatively high amount per student, ranging from $10,637 to $16,762 per student in recent years, it has a low student-teacher ratio, which may indicate a need for more resources and support for students.
